Does the pure edition of the 2014 moto x still contain Moto's custom apps for this phone such as Moto Display and the always listening feature, or is it truly stock android?

From my searching, it seems like it does have these, but I never found a post where anyone came right out and said it point blank. I'm thinking about buying the Moto X PE very soon, but it sounds like Motos custom apps are actually quite desirable. However, I'd really hate carrier bloatware, plus I'm leaning towards the 64 Gb, which is only available with the Pure Edition.
 
Motos customs apps will be on there. Its standard on all moto x 2014 phones because well, its from Motorola. Its like how when you get a carrier phone, it comes with the carrier bloat ware apps. When you get the moto x, you'll get the moto apps! It doesn't matter if you get the carrier phone or if you get the pure edition. The moto x is basically stock android, with Motorola's very small touches like the moto apps. I hope this helps!
